So, Lucien Casgrain: St-Cul-de-Jatte Live! is this quirky comedy that kind of defies easy categorization. It has this laid-back vibe that feels almost like a series of vignettes strung together, with a script that dances between absurdity and the mundane. The performances lean into the offbeat, and there's a certain charm in how the characters interact, often feeling like you're eavesdropping on their lives. Practical effects are used here with a light touch, adding to that 'real life' feel without overshadowing the narrative. It's distinctive for its local flavor and humor, making it a slice-of-life piece that captures a specific cultural essence, yet it somehow manages to resonate beyond that. The pacing is a bit meandering, which might not be for everyone, but it has this warm, inviting atmosphere that keeps you engaged.
